Nikhil Dwivedi Defends Aishwarya Rai, Abhishek Bachchan Amid Divorce Rumors: 'They Were a Couple...'

In the midst of swirling rumors surrounding Aishwarya Rai and Abhishek Bachchan's marriage, their colleague from the film industry, actor Nikhil Dwivedi, has come forward to offer a different perspective. Dwivedi, who has shared screen space with the couple, recently opened up about his observations of their relationship during their time on set.

According to him, the duo exudes the essence of a married couple, both in their affection for each other and their professional demeanor. "They're a married couple, so naturally, they have the bond of husband and wife. We've never seen them apart," Dwivedi remarked in a discussion with Filmgyan Viral. His insights provide a counter-narrative to the divorce speculation that has been rampant.

Dwivedi, having worked closely with Aishwarya and Abhishek in the 2010 movie 'Raavan’, directed by Mani Ratnam, observed their dynamics firsthand. Despite the film's failure at the box office, he recalls their strong partnership both on and off the camera. He vehemently denies any lack of professionalism on their part, stating, "If you're asking whether they were less professional, absolutely not. They were highly professional, and yes, they are a couple." His statement sheds light on their commitment to their work, despite their personal lives being under constant scrutiny.

Amidst the rumors of discord, Nikhil Dwivedi has not only highlighted the couple's professionalism but also shared personal accolades for both Aishwarya and Abhishek. He described Abhishek Bachchan as polite and well-mannered, and Aishwarya Rai Bachchan as approachable and easy to converse with. These personal touches add a layer of humanity to the stars, often seen only through the lens of their public personas.

The speculation was further fueled by the absence of the Bachchan family's public birthday wishes for Aishwarya's 51st birthday, leading many to speculate about a rift within the family. However, the absence of a public acknowledgment from either party keeps the truth behind these speculations shrouded in mystery.

On the work front, while Aishwarya Rai Bachchan's latest film role was in the 2023 release 'Ponniyin Selvan: II', she hasn't confirmed any new projects. Contrastingly, Abhishek Bachchan is preparing for his role in upcoming films, including Shoojit Sircar's 'I Want to Talk and Housefull 5', slated for a 2025 release.
